Tomar Williams, the fifth of seven children was born into a musical family in Las Vegas, Nevada. His father, after leaving the Air Force, played saxophone in a band, the “Moon Gliders”, and his mother sang in a family gospel group the “Lamkin Five”. All kinds of music filled the Williams household, including many soul records, which had a deep influence on Tomar and his siblings.
